Exceptions
to the Schedule
While you are a resident at New Beginnings there will be times when you will have a need that can only be met by missing part of the schedule. When this occurs1 all you need to do is speak to your Counselor or the Clinical Director and ask permission to miss the scheduled event. If your reason is valid, permission will be granted. Present a written permission statement.
THINGS TO REMEMBERThe staff of New Beginnings has devised a code of conduct which will assist you in:
1. recovering from your disease
2. living with others like yourself
3. increasing your self-esteem
4. developing a lifestyle which is positive
5. letting go of your old negative lifestyle
It goes without saying that if you choose to be rebellious and not follow the rules, or if you are a people pleaser, manipulator and do enough just to get by, you will not benefit from this. The choice is yours. Let go and Let God!
There are many rules, regulations, expectations, and responsibilities embodied in our manual. We have done as thorough a job as we could to include all rules, etc. which exist, however, there will always be new situations which require new ideas. Be flexible and remember that the staff is human, we make mistakes, but we are here to help and not hinder you.
